Map values are now handled correctly regardless of the actual Map value type declaration (can be Object in the most open case). We now handle collections as Map value types correctly. BasicDBList instances are now hinted to become Lists by default (if not typed to another collection type by the property).
Reduced visibility of MappingMongoConverter.addCustomTypeKeyIfNecessary(…) and made createCollectionDBObject(…) safe against null values for the TypeInformation.
BasicQuery accidentally shadowed limit and skip fields of Query and introduced setters instead of builder style mutators. This caused the getters not returning the values set throughout the mutators which essentially turned off pagination for manually defined queries.
Removed the shadowing and created test case. Refactored constructors.
Removed quite some obsolete methods from MongoConverter interface. Renamed maybeConvertObject(…) to convertToMongoType(…). Moved implementation of that method into MappingMongoConverter. Let the implementation transparently use custom Converters as well. Removed SimpleMongoConverter. Switched QueryMapper implementation from using a MongoConverter to use a ConversionService. Removed custom "maybe convert" logic from ConvertingParameterAccessor in favor of MongoWriter.convertToMongo(…).
Added converter to handle BigInteger values. Adapted id handling to try converting and object to String before taking the id as is. Made custom converter implementations safe against invocations with null.
Replaced hard coded List creation with delegate to Spring's CollectionFactory. Although the List should get converted before setting the value we can prevent that additional step by looking up the correct collection type upfront.
Unfortunately MongoDB can't handle BigDecimal instances by default thus we have to provide a default serialization. We do by simply serializing it into a String and reading it back. Can be customized to register a custom Converter with the MongoConverter.
Disabled index creation for repository query methods by default. Added property on MongoRepositoryFactoryBean to enable index creation and expose that via 'create-query-indexes' attribute on the namespace.
Changed the implementation of the exists(…) method to make sure the query is handed to the QueryMapper to convert the id appropriately before executing the query.
Entities can now use @Field annotation to define the order using the order attribute. We will simply start with the lower values and proceed to the higher ones. Unannotated properties are ordered behind all annotated (and order declared) ones. One might not assume any particular order for fields where the order is not manually defined.
Removed @FieldName as it is superseeded by @Field.
